Output cebb824ede173a5da15a7164ee14792d2bdb6c6a23c1d084cb27a78294c34705:63

value
665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ae753ec82d5005a24c259c5774253a3ca7b7bdc OP_EQUAL
address
374UEcHTsRb7zJAosUEhKgbdEnuDNfYS4E
transaction
cebb824ede173a5da15a7164ee14792d2bdb6c6a23c1d084cb27a78294c34705
spent
true